first try a different pool.
second check your router to make sure its not blocking the miner in some way. It seems like the issue is network related, check your router's settings. Some have automatic firewalls for unrecognized machines.
third open the miner and make sure all the plugs are connected tightly and the lights from the modules are working as well.
